Conclusion Meanings:

'Exonerated': or 'Within NYPD Guidelines' - the alleged conduct occurred but did not violate the NYPD's own rules, which often give officers significant discretion.
'Unsubstantiated': or 'Unable to Determine' - CCRB has fully investigated but could not affirmatively conclude both that the conduct occurred and that it broke the rules.

Beckford, Clemente, et al. vs City of New York, et al.
Case # 16CV02261, U.S. District Court - Southern District NY, April 12, 2016, ended May 1, 2017
Order/Judgment (Verdict)
Complaint
Description: Plaintiffs were present in front of their home when defendant officers approached, handcuffed, and searched one of the Plaintiff 1. Plaintiffs 2 and 3 asked why he was being arrested and started recording the incident so defendant officers arrested them as well. Plaintiff 3 was released without charges, Plaintiff 2 was charged with OGA, and Plaintiff 1 was charged with Sale of a Controlled Substance in the Third Degree. All charges were dismissed.
